    Hardcover. Condition: Good. 1st Edition. Frölich, Karl; Chatelain (trans), Karl Fröhlich's Frolicks with Scissors and Pen. The Rhymes translated and adapted from the original German of Frölich, Joseph Myers (1860). First Edition. Brown cloth with blind stamped gilt design to front board bearing the title, and a blind stamped floral design around both boards. Fresh endpapers have been laid down. Internally mostly clean with occasional spotting and browning, but some creasing to leaves in the introduction and a small tear on page vii/viii which does not affect text. All illustrated plates (25) present showcasing Frölich's wonderful silhouette work. Some sunning to the spine of the book an some minor marking to the front board. Good. A very scarce item in commerce, and a joy to read. It is a book of 25 poems, translated from German to English by Madame de Chatelain, such as, 'The Unlucky Sportsman', 'Two Quarrelsome Sprits', 'Sloth and Pride: A Fable', with each poem having a black and white silhouette printed at the top. Frölich was the son of a shoemaker, but found a love of art and started to use scissors. It appears that this was issued in several colours of cloth bindings.

    Hardcover. Condition: Very Good. No Jacket. 3rd Edition. Dolly's Picture Book with Twelve Original Coloured Designs. Translated from the German by Madame de Chatelain. Third Edition. Stuttgart, Theinemann's / London, A N Myers by Rudolph Geissler, translated by Madam de Chatelain, CIRCA 1870, with letterpress title page and 12 hand-coloured plates including a second pictorial title page, the other 11 plates with letterpress title and verse description on separate page facing, original embossed gold on white paper boards with sellers name of A N Myers on lower board, edges gilt, THIRD EDITION; the German origins of this doll or doll's house book are evident from the presentation and imprint, and although not by definition a miniature book a copy of the fourth edition was including in the 2006 Christie's sale of miniatures from the collection of Nigel Temple. A similar but genuinely miniature title is described by Bondy and seems likely that several similar books were produced to be sold beside dolls and related items in the London toy shop of Myers, later Cremer Junior.
